Output a884606328303d35daeb3fce5cf179140a3ac4e211263ba4a1489a9d0fa54f0a:0

value
20580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c8fb30ead64e08ab2aeba7dadcce66abd9c2d5c OP_EQUAL
address
3LLdv69FkQJT74si8UipFfVnhpsPjH9a5h
transaction
a884606328303d35daeb3fce5cf179140a3ac4e211263ba4a1489a9d0fa54f0a
spent
true